Output 515f866bf8d4a5fe7b43a79acb65f674d3b501cdf55f3c8dfd7fa09d9949e28d:1

value
17260422
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86b060845a8373ab93814658ffede74bff59f54c OP_EQUALVERIFY OP_CHECKSIG
address
1DHAqbY421WLcU78qhYVjFTqsmNGWhc2Gu
transaction
515f866bf8d4a5fe7b43a79acb65f674d3b501cdf55f3c8dfd7fa09d9949e28d
confirmations
581202
spent
true